Understanding Time Delay Relays
When I first started exploring the world of electronics, I came across time delay relays. These devices are essential for controlling the timing of electrical circuits. Essentially, they allow me to delay the activation or deactivation of a device, providing greater flexibility in my projects.
Why Choose a 12V Time Delay Relay?
I found that 12V time delay relays are particularly popular because they are compatible with many automotive and low-voltage applications. This voltage level provides a balance between safety and functionality. It’s ideal for projects such as automotive lighting, home automation systems, and various DIY electronics.
Key Features to Consider
As I browsed through different options, I realized that several features are crucial to consider:
- Adjustable Delay Time: I appreciate being able to customize the delay time according to my project’s needs. Some relays offer a wide range of delay options, from seconds to minutes.
- Switching Capacity: It’s important to check the relay’s switching capacity to ensure it can handle the load of the device I want to control. I always make sure the relay can support the current and voltage requirements.
- Operating Temperature: Depending on where I plan to use the relay, I take note of its operating temperature range. Some applications may expose the relay to extreme conditions, so I choose accordingly.
- Type of Delay: I learned that there are different types of time delays, such as ON-delay and OFF-delay. Understanding the specific needs of my project helps me select the right type.
